Faye Evans Craft was taken into the arms of the Lord on Sept. 27, 2006 in Palm Springs, Her faith was an integral part of her life. She was a member of St. Theresa's Catholic Church Faye was born Dec. 24, 1910 in Oklahoma, the sixth of seven children of migrant farm workers. During the course of her life, she married John E. Evans. Four children were born to this union. Later she married John Craft. Left to honor her memory are her children, Catherine Durr, Mary Faith Knapp, Robert Evans and John Evans. Her legacy of life also included sixteen grandchildren, twenty-one great-grandchildren, and sixteen great-great-grandchildren. Faye was a self-made, self educated woman who journeyed far from very meager beginnings. She was a woman of strong opinions, a hard worker, and a perfectionist who expected no less from those around her. As were her wishes, Faye was cremated. A celebration of life will be held at Windsor Court Assisted Living Facility. Private family services will follow at a later date with inurnment at Linwood Cemetery in Cedar Rapids, Iowa.
